Output df5677d06714eaad41f63023f601cb88a565aebe554bb153daeb1ebe17913d59:95

value
512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225faa0268cf76ce501112a2dc227b3f2a608cd9 OP_EQUAL
address
34pmVvZ2ww71pqAU1JjVopwimQdpoaEcxX
transaction
df5677d06714eaad41f63023f601cb88a565aebe554bb153daeb1ebe17913d59
spent
true